Chevy Traverse Towing Capacity
What is the maximum amount of a Chevrolet Traverse towing? It is estimated that the 2022 Chevy Traverse is able to carry up to 5,000 lbs using its 3.6L V6 engine.
This 3.6L V6 engine is included in all 2022 Chevy Traverse trim levels and it puts out 300 horsepower and 266 pounds of torque. Learn more about the towing options in the following paragraphs:
The Trailer Sway Control: Trailer Sway Control is a component of the Stabilitrak(r) Electronic Stability Control System.
The control detects that the trailer is moving and will apply brakes in order to achieve course correction.
The available trailering package Optional Chevy Traverse tow package offers Westfield as well as Dunkirk drivers the option to connect a trailer that has an additional hitch and tow it further without overheating, thanks to the powerful cooling system.
tow/haul mode Driver Mode Control allows you to automatically change the transmission’s settings from FWD AWD, Off-Road, and Tow/Haul modes.
The transmission will produce more torque by remaining in the lower gear longer. Then, as the vehicle is moving downhill the transmission will downshift to keep the speed steady without using the brakes.

Chevy Trailering Package
Chevy has an available trailering option, specifically tailored to the model that allows vehicles to be outfitted with heavy-duty equipment to maximize the towing capacity. For the Chevy Traverse the trailering package comes with the following features:
- A factory-installed hitch
- Heavy-duty cooling system for the heavy-duty cooling
- Towing assistance features, such as Hill Start Assist and Tow/Haul Mode.
Some models also come with Hitch Guidance along with Hitch View.
Be aware that the towing capacity increase of 5,000 pounds implies that the engine and gears have to be adjusted to handle the extra weight.
This is why your towing capacity will be limited by the Traverse that isn’t equipped with the system. Just installing a hitch won’t suffice, and it will limit you to tow between 1,500 and 2500lbs (depending on the engine).
Chevy Traverse Towing Table
It is expected to be launched in 2022. Chevy Traverse tows capacity of between 1,500 and 5000 pounds depending upon whether it is equipped with a tow kit installed.
A 2022 Chevy Traverse with no trailering Package can tow 1,500 pounds.
2022 Chevy Traverse equipped with the Trailering Package can haul 5,000 pounds.
Chevy TraverseTrim Level | Towing Capacity | Engine | Horsepower | Torque | V92 Trailering Package |
LS | 1,500 lbs / 680 kg | 3.6L V6 | 310 hp | 266 lb.-ft | No |
LT | 1,500 lbs / 680 kg | 3.6L V6 | 310 hp | 266 lb.-ft | No |
LT | 5,000 lbs / 2,267 kg | 3.6L V6 | 310 hp | 266 lb.-ft | Yes |
RS | 1,500 lbs / 680 kg | 3.6L V6 | 310 hp | 266 lb.-ft | No |
RS | 5,000 lbs / 2,267 kg | 3.6L V6 | 310 hp | 266 lb.-ft | Yes |
Premier | 1,500 lbs / 680 kg | 3.6L V6 | 310 hp | 266 lb.-ft | No |
Premier | 5,000 lbs / 2,267 kg | 3.6L V6 | 310 hp | 266 lb.-ft | Yes |
High Country | 5,000 lbs / 2,267 kg | 3.6L V6 | 310 hp | 266 lb.-ft | Yes |

Chevy Traverse Towing Capacity 2019
Depending on which engine you choose, the Chevy Traverse’s towing capacity ranges from 1,500 to 5,000 pounds:
In 2019, Chevy Traverse’s capacity for towing is contingent on the engine you select. Learn more about the engine you want below:
- 2.0L Turbocharged I4 engine
- The maximum towing capacity is 1,500 pounds.
- 257 HP
- 295 pounds of torque
- Estimated fuel economy by the EPA: 20 mpg in the city and 26 mpg on the highway.
- 3.6L V6 engine
- The maximum towing capacity is 5,000 pounds.
- 315 HP
- 266 pounds of torque
- Estimated fuel economy by the EPA: 18 mpg city/27 highway
